By Glen Don THE MEDIA COUNCIL’S VISIT TO KISII UNIVERSITY The Kisii University Media students on Saturday 10, February will have the privilege of meeting their umbrella body, the Media Council of Kenya (MCK). The MCK’s official visit will commence tomorrow Saturday until Monday 12, February with various activities set to take place within the period of the visit. In the schedule, on Saturday the opening activity will be Students' talk and career guidance, on Sunday it will be sports day where Kisii Journalists will have a match against Kisumu journalists and on Monday there will be a separate round-table meeting with the lecturers, training for the journalists, lecturers and students then finally training for communication team and journalists on access to information. This will mark the end of their three-day visit to Kisii.
